Pros
DoiT gives people real agency; there’s very little micromanagement, and you’re expected to own your domain and make decisions, not wait for approval on every step. That trust goes both ways and makes the work more satisfying. The people are smart, practical, and genuinely care about customers. Leadership is also unusually transparent about business metrics and the overall health of the company, which is refreshing for a company at this stage. Remote-first actually works here because expectations are clear and people are treated like adults.
Cons
Priorities can shift quickly and the pace can feel intense at times. Processes are still evolving, which can create ambiguity if you prefer highly structured environments. You need to be comfortable with change and with building while flying.
